Output 1505984fecfee52511840eb61aa4e08c2ebfbdee514365c9739b556c346e0b32:0

value
2122001
script pubkey
OP_HASH160 OP_PUSHBYTES_20 6b03a837f24589b936441096c5f97e020c0916bc OP_EQUAL
address
3BSrcAnsrMpmiHJu7Sorm5uXSGp3fsa44o
transaction
1505984fecfee52511840eb61aa4e08c2ebfbdee514365c9739b556c346e0b32
confirmations
90745
spent
true